Twenty-One Years of Excellence:

Elevating Fluor Field and the Greenville Drive Experience for 2026

GREENVILLE, S.C., (March 16, 2026) — Coming off a 20th Anniversary championship-caliber season that saw the Greenville Drive solidify its place as a cornerstone of the Upstate, the club is set to raise the bar even higher for the 2026 season.

Following a year of historic milestones — including a feature on CBS Evening News, earning the Greenville Chamber’s Small Business of the Year Award, honoring team owner Craig Brown with the Order of the Palmetto, and helping Greenville earn a top spot in USA Today’s Best Baseball Towns — the Drive is returning to Fluor Field with a renewed focus on what makes "The Front Porch" of the community special: world-class entertainment that remains accessible to everyone.

While the Drive season begins on April 2nd, the true story of the 2026 season is a transformed fan experience defined by "What’s New" along with a steadfast commitment to affordability.

Elevated Luxury: The New Suite Level

Fluor Field’s Luxury Suites have undergone a total transformation to provide a premium hospitality experience:

  • Modern Design: Suites now feature floor-to-ceiling glass facing the field, paired with all-new cabinetry, countertops, and high-end finishes.
  • Tech & Taste: Each suite is equipped with a 75” HD TV and new induction cooking surfaces and new refrigerators to streamline food and beverage service.
  • Flexibility: These spaces are available for season-long, multi-year leases or nightly rentals for special occasions.

Speed & Tech: The Shortstop Self-Serve Market

Located behind home plate (formerly the Subway stand), the all-new Shortstop Self-Serve Market is designed for the fan who doesn't want to miss a single pitch. This "grab-and-go" destination features:

  • A wide selection of hot and cold food, snacks, and both al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ages.
  • Speedy self-checkout technology to get fans back to their seats instantly.
  • For those who prefer to stay put, sEATz (powered by AFL) continues to offer in-app ordering with direct-to-seat delivery.

Fully Upgraded Ballpark IT Infrastructure and MLB Wi-Fi Experience

The Drive have invested heavily in its Wi-Fi infrastructure and can now offer a faster, more reliable, and seamless wireless experience. Provided by Extreme Networks, the Official Wi-Fi Solutions Provider of Major League Baseball, the new, dedicated, secure guest Wi-Fi network has 5x the bandwidth and 60 percent more coverage than before. More point-of-sale terminals have also been added for faster checkouts and shorter lines; and the new Shortstop self-serve market features interactive AI checkouts with a 15-second average transaction time!

About The Greenville Drive

The Greenville Drive –– the Upstate’s “Home Team” –– is the High-A affiliate of the Boston Red Sox and premier Minor League franchise celebrated for seven consecutive years of league-leading attendance and a #1 ranking as MiLB’s most affordable organization. Playing at award-winning Fluor Field — recently voted by fans as one of the Top 3 Single-A ballparks in the nation — the team has produced 131 Major Leaguers and earned the prestigious John H. Johnson President’s Award for excellence. A mini replica of Fenway Park, Fluor Field has been a catalyst for the redevelopment of Greenville’s West End. Called the "front porch" of downtown Greenville, Fluor Field welcomes an average of 500,000 guests each year for baseball games and more than 150 community events. From its iconic Green Monster to record-breaking player development, the Drive is a cornerstone of the Greenville community.
